Transaction 709581c0e8ed92c72c89615c20ed4583e5c62826bfcd075b38e036c157035fe9
2 Input
2 Outputs
- 709581c0e8ed92c72c89615c20ed4583e5c62826bfcd075b38e036c157035fe9:0
- 709581c0e8ed92c72c89615c20ed4583e5c62826bfcd075b38e036c157035fe9:1
value 71388
address 15F8M7wmVhbMU9AiKAc7RnQBiFgdbugEwC
value 4260000
address 3EarnzCXN7J5ejF9RVFkGmHstZ8AxhqRmQ